Let me take you back to the time when Israel was in slavery, a time when they grew so use to being in Egypt, use to the comforts and the wealth that Egypt had given them.

But the comforts of Egypt made it hard for them to let go even though they were in bondage, even though they could see what was happening, they were trapped in a situation that would soon become more than they bargained for.

That’s the problem that many have today. They are too used to the bondage to let God lead them out to freedom.
Used to the drinking, the adultery, and the life that soon become their master.

But there is help. God wants to turn your captivity into freedom and turn your misery to peace. He wants to turn your dead life to a life of love and forgiveness.

When Moses was born his mother hid him as long as she could and finally she had to succumb to the pressure and the will of God even though she didn’t understand at the time what God was doing.

Moses was taken to the house of Pharaoh as a baby, trained and educated as an Egyptian, in his youth. I wonder if it ever crossed his mind that Egypt, the land that fed him, gave him power as a Prince, educated him and gave him worldly knowledge, would be the place that God used him to deliver?

Did it ever cross his mind that one day God would choose him to deliver this multitude of slaves?
 
Has it crossed your mind this morning that God wants to use you, but the world is training you to be successful, and giving you worldly pleasures tempting you with life’s pleasure, a life with no restrictions?

I want to tell you something today; God does things in a mysterious way. He uses people no one would have ever thought He would use, to do many mighty acts by his mighty hand.

Time was desperate for Israel. They were no longer welcome guests in Egypt as they were when Joseph was second to Pharaoh.

They were given Goshen, the most fertile of all the land of Egypt, by Pharaoh himself because of the mighty wisdom of Joseph.

You can’t come to God wanting to hold on to sin, you must come willing to forsake it all in true heartfelt repentance, willing to lay aside all the sins and abominations that have kept you in captivity and separated you from Him.

God says in Jeremiah 24:7,
"Then I will give them a heart to know Me, that I am the Lord; and they shall be My people, and I will be their God, for they shall return to Me with their whole heart."


Israel’s only hold back from serving God was they couldn’t let go of their slavery. They had become so used to slavery they couldn’t accept the very thing they had desired for four hundred years and that was deliverance.

When deliverance came, the excitement was high, but as they began their journey to the promise land, they kept looking back and refused the counsel of Moses and God grew weary with their backsliding and they died by the thousands in the wilderness.

They even got so far as the promise land. They saw the milk and the honey and the land that God had promised to give them and they turned back to the wilderness, back to wandering in darkness.

Many have started this journey to the Promised Land, the place that John described as heaven, only to get close enough to feel it and then look back.

They died in that wilderness, that close to glory, that close to the promise of God, that close to complete deliverance and they turned back.

But I have good news, all you have to do is start your journey again and not look back, not worry about what will I have to give up? But think on this, just ahead there is a promise that God will give you your inheritance.

Israel knew the commandments of God. If they were to come back they would have to come back willing to follow God and not their own way. They had to keep the commandments of the Lord and walk in his statues.

But when we come to God, we cannot make the rules, we cannot bribe Him with vain promises;
We have to surrender and follow God.
  
Beloved, only they that followed Moses and Joshua made it.
And only they that follow Jesus will make it.
If you aren’t willing to give him all it will never work.
